最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E
标题:探索未来编程的新纪元——ollama引领智能化开发的变革
在当今数字化时代,编程已成为推动技术创新的核心力量。随着人工智能(AI)技术的飞速发展,越来越多的开发者开始借助智能化工具来提升编程效率和质量。其中,ollama作为一款前沿的AI驱动的开发助手,正逐渐成为编程领域的热门话题。本文将探讨ollama如何通过智能化技术革新编程体验,并介绍一个强大的应用实例——InsCode AI IDE,展示其在实际开发中的巨大价值。
ollama:开启智能编程新时代
ollama是一款基于深度学习的AI编程助手,它能够理解自然语言描述并自动生成代码,帮助开发者快速完成编程任务。通过与ollama的交互,即使是编程新手也能轻松实现复杂的编码工作。ollama不仅支持多种编程语言,还能提供智能代码补全、错误修复、性能优化等功能,极大提升了开发效率。
实战应用:InsCode AI IDE——ollama的最佳拍档
为了更好地理解ollama的实际应用场景,我们以InsCode AI IDE为例,看看这款由优快云、GitCode和华为云CodeArts IDE联合开发的AI跨平台集成开发环境(IDE),如何与ollama完美结合,为开发者带来前所未有的编程体验。
1. 快速上手,轻松编程
InsCode AI IDE内置了ollama的AI对话框,使得编程初学者也能通过简单的自然语言交流快速实现代码生成、修改项目代码、生成注释等操作。例如,在开发一个贪吃蛇游戏时,用户只需输入“创建一个贪吃蛇游戏”,AI便会自动生成完整的代码框架,包括游戏逻辑、界面设计等。这种革命性的编程方式,让开发者能够专注于创意和设计,极大地降低了编程难度,缩短了开发周期。
2. 智能问答,解决编程难题
在实际开发过程中,开发者常常会遇到各种各样的问题。InsCode AI IDE的智能问答功能允许用户通过自然对话与AI互动,以应对编程领域的多种挑战。无论是代码解析、语法指导、优化建议,还是编写测试案例,AI都能提供详细的解答和解决方案。比如,当用户遇到一个难以调试的Bug时,只需将错误信息告诉AI,AI就能迅速定位问题并给出修复建议,大大提高了问题解决的效率。
3. 全局改写,优化项目结构
对于大型项目,代码的组织和管理尤为重要。InsCode AI IDE支持全局代码生成/改写,能够理解整个项目结构,并生成或修改多个文件,甚至包含生成图片资源。这意味着开发者可以轻松重构代码,优化项目结构,提高代码的可维护性和扩展性。例如,在开发图书借阅系统时,用户可以通过ollama提供的全局改写功能,快速调整数据库模型、业务逻辑等关键部分,确保系统的高效运行。
4. 自动化测试,保障代码质量
单元测试是保证代码质量的重要手段。InsCode AI IDE具备为代码生成单元测试用例的能力,帮助开发者快速验证代码的准确性,提高代码的测试覆盖率和质量。通过自动化测试,开发者可以在每次提交代码前进行全面检查,确保新功能不会引入新的Bug,从而提升项目的稳定性。
5. 性能优化,提升运行效率
在追求高性能的应用场景中,代码的优化至关重要。InsCode AI IDE能够轻松理解代码逻辑,对代码性能进行分析,找出性能瓶颈并执行优化方案。例如,在开发一个实时数据分析系统时,开发者可以利用ollama的性能优化功能,自动识别并改进代码中的低效部分,使系统运行更加流畅和高效。
引领未来,共创辉煌
随着AI技术的不断进步,ollama和InsCode AI IDE这样的智能化工具正在改变编程的方式和流程。它们不仅简化了开发过程,还为开发者提供了更多的创新空间。无论你是经验丰富的程序员,还是刚刚入门的编程爱好者,都可以从这些工具中受益匪浅。
结语:立即行动,下载InsCode AI IDE
为了让更多的开发者体验到智能化编程的魅力,我们强烈推荐您下载并试用InsCode AI IDE。这款集成了ollama强大功能的IDE,将为您带来全新的编程体验,助您在激烈的市场竞争中脱颖而出。现在就加入这场编程革命,共同迎接未来的无限可能!
通过这篇文章,我们不仅展示了ollama在智能化编程中的重要作用,还详细介绍了InsCode AI IDE的实际应用场景和巨大价值。希望读者能够从中感受到AI技术给编程带来的变革,并积极尝试使用这些先进的工具,提升自己的开发效率和创新能力。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考